Resumen
Las redes inalámbricas de sensores inteligentes (RISI) son un tipo de red Ad_Hoc. Nacieron gracias al avance
extraordinario de la nanotecnología que permitió lograr costos adecuados, tamaño reducido, bajo consumo de
potencia y procesamiento limitado. Estas redes están compuestas de nodos, llamados nodos sensores.
Se propone un algoritmo de ruteo para dichas redes en el cual consideramos como camino óptimo de los
mensajes hacia el sink, al que incluya la menor cantidad de saltos. El algoritmo presentado es tolerante a fallos
en la red, y propone soluciones para reconfigurar la misma y hallar rutas alternativas al sink. Además la red
garantiza la llegada de los mensajes a la estación base.
The wireless sensor networks (WSN) are Ad_Hoc networks. They were born thanks to the extraordinary advance of the nanotechnology that allowed to achieve suitable costs, limited(small) size, low power consumption and limited processing. These network structures are based on nodes, called sensor nodes. A routing algorithm is proposed. The ideal way of the messages towards the sink includes the minor quantity of hop. The algorithm is tolerant to failures in the network, and proposes solutions to re-set it and to find alternative routes to the sink. Besides, the arrival of the messages to the base station is guaranteed.
